About 3,3,3-trifluoro-N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]propanamide
3,3,3-trifluoro-N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]propanamide (PubChem CID 121181887) has the molecular formula C10H10F3N5O2
and a molecular weight of 289.22 g/mol. Its IUPAC name is 3,3,3-trifluoro-N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]propanamide.

What is the SMILES notation for 3,3,3-trifluoro-N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]propanamide?
The canonical SMILES for 3,3,3-trifluoro-N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]propanamide is COc1ccc2nnc(CNC(=O)CC(F)(F)F)n2n1.
What is the InChIKey of 3,3,3-trifluoro-N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]propanamide?
The InChIKey is FHBHJFAXFIIVGJ-UHFFFAOYSA-N. The full InChI is InChI=1S/C10H10F3N5O2/c1-20-9-3-2-6-15-16-7(18(6)17-9)5-14-8(19)4-10(11,12)13/h2-3H,4-5H2,1H3,(H,14,19).
What are the key properties of 3,3,3-trifluoro-N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]propanamide?
3,3,3-trifluoro-N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]propanamide has a molecular weight of 289.22 g/mol, XLogP of 0.70, 4 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
